We are aware that there may be problems that could occur during the filming of our second draft. These problems must be taken into account if the filming is to be done properly and in a way that will gain the best results.
The first issue that I am most concerned over is that of the weather. When we first filmed our shots at the two outside locations we were fortunate enough to have sunny weather which benefited the lighting of the whole shoot. The weather will not be such a problem for the inside shoot in the warehouse, as the lighting is always the same. However we will need particularly good weather for the Croft hill shoot and thus must plan according to what we are forecasted.
A second problem we might have when filming is acquiring lifts to the locations. This would be a problem as neither of us in the band can drive and are thus receiving lifts to the locations. This won't be a problem if careful planning and preparations are put in in good course.
A problem we faced last time we shot in Rhys's garage was that we did not take into account the length of time it would take to set up and prepare the location to how we wanted it to be. This time we can prepare in good time. Hopefully we can set up the location the night before and thus when we arrive we can just film as we will be filming after school and will not have as much time as before.
Overall, the main thing we must focus on is being prepared. We have to make sure that batteries are charged,tripods are in place and that the location is set up correctly.
